Why upgrade windows can feel confusing

Upgrading windows often starts with a simple goal: reduce drafts, improve comfort, and refresh the look of a home. The challenge is that window problems can look similar on the surface, yet the cause may differ—poor sealing, outdated hardware, or inadequate thermal performance. When you Aluminum windows only focus on appearance, you can miss the underlying issues that keep energy costs high or let outside noise in. A clear problem-solution approach helps narrow down what you need, rather than guessing and risking an imperfect fit.

Many homeowners notice symptoms like condensation, uneven airflow, or difficulty opening and closing frames. These issues are frequently linked to aging materials, worn gaskets, and frames that no longer align correctly after years of use. Even small gaps around the perimeter can create a path for air leakage, which then increases heating and cooling demand. Selecting the right window system requires matching performance expectations with practical installation details, including measurements and weatherproofing.

Common window problems and practical fixes

One frequent concern is heat loss and heat gain, which shows up as rooms feeling uncomfortable despite thermostat changes. Poor insulation is often tied to frame design, glazing type, and how well the window seals against the structure. Upgrading to high-performing Glass online window solutions can help stabilize indoor temperatures by reducing conductive and radiant heat transfer. The goal is not only to “keep warmth in,” but to create a consistent comfort level across the entire home.

Another issue is water ingress, which may present as dampness around trims or recurring condensation on colder surfaces. This can occur when drainage paths are blocked, seals degrade, or installation misses proper sealing points. The solution is a window setup built for durability and engineered to handle Australian conditions, including airflow management and robust weatherproofing. When you address sealing and alignment as seriously as the glass itself, you reduce the risk of recurring moisture problems.

How to choose the right window solution

To choose effectively, start with the function of each opening, such as ventilation needs, privacy requirements, and the amount of sunlight you want. Fixed and operable styles serve different purposes, and matching the style to your layout prevents wasted spend. A well-planned configuration can also improve long-term usability, since some openings are meant to be opened frequently while others are designed primarily for performance and structure. Taking accurate measurements is essential because even minor differences can affect sealing and visual finish.
